Locatora Radio is a weekly podcast dedicated to archiving the present and shifting the culture forward. Hosted by Mala Muñoz and Diosa Femme, two IG friends turned podcast partners. They break down pop culture, current events, and feminism through nuanced interviews with Latinx creatives and artists. Founded in 2016, Locatora Radio was podcasting independently until joining iHeartRadio's My Cultura Podcast Network in 2022.

In this week's capítulo of Locatora Radio, award-winning investigative journalist and author, Peniley Ramírez discusses the making of a new Futuro Media and MyCultura Podcast, "Chess Piece: The Elian Gonzalez Story". This podcast tells the polarizing story of five-year-old, Elian Gonzalez, who was rescued near the Florida coast after his mother and others drowned in the Florida straits after fleeing Cuba. Peniley joins us to discuss how she immersed herself in this podcast and revealed her own story of family separation, exile, and Cuban identity both on and off the island. The San Gabriel Band of Mission Indians, Tongva-Gabrielino, are the first and only state recognized tribe in the LA area, but how much do we actually know about the first Angelenos? In this capítulo, we’re joined by Samantha Johnson Yang and Mona Morales Recalde to discuss the history of the Tongva, their efforts to stop the poaching of white sage from Southern California wildlife reserves, and an ongoing battle to protect and preserve their tribal identity. Faketina (n): a person without roots in Latin America who masquerades as Latinx in order to obtain jobs, scholarships, titles, and opportunities meant for people of Latin American descent. Today’s episode is a review of some of the most notorious Faketinas who made the news and left us asking - what the fuck??? Tune in across platforms and SUBSCRIBE to Locatora Radio!
